232,650 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
232650 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seventy-two divisors.
Prime factorization of 232650:
2 × 32 × 52 × 11 × 47
(2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 11 × 47)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 232650 from the Numbermatics database.

Factors of 232650
Divisors of 232650
- Number of divisors d(n): 72
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 3 5 6 9 10 11 15 18 22 25 30 33 45 47 50 55 66 75 90 94 99 110 141 150 165 198 225 235 275 282 330 423 450 470 495 517 550 705 825 846 990 1034 1175 1410 1551 1650 2115 2350 2475 2585 3102 3525 4230 4653 4950 5170 7050 7755 9306 10575 12925 15510 21150 23265 25850 38775 46530 77550 116325 232650
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 696384
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 463734
- 232650 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(463734)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 231084
